Definition of growth: More than 20% increase in at least two dimensions AND a minimal increase of 2mm OR ; More than 50% increase in volume. Thyroid nodules that have benign biopsy results still need to be followed by ultrasound surveillance and nodules that significantly grow need to undergo a 2nd biopsy to ensure the initial biopsy did not miss a cancer. Treatment for a benign thyroid nodule may range from close monitoring to the use of drug therapy or surgery. Benign nodules can grow, so the fact that the nodule is slowly growing is not especially worrisome.
